Fleabag star Phoebe Waller-Bridge is close to signing on for a role in the Young Han Solo movie.
The 31-year-old actress might play a performance-capture character opposite Alden Ehrenreich's new version of Harrison Ford's galactic smuggler, reported Variety.
The movie is currently filming, with Donald Glover, Woody Harrelson, and Emilia Clarke.
The LEGO Movie and 21 Jump Street filmmakers Phil Lord and Chris Miller are directing the project, and the untitled movie is set for release in 2018.
If the negotiations clear all the hurdles, Waller-Bridge will be in the company of Andy Serkis, Lupita Nyong'o, and Alan Tudyk who play (using motion-capture techniques) Supreme Leader Snoke, Maz Katana, and droid K-2SO, respectively, in the Star Wars universe.
The Young Han Solo movie is set before the events of Star Wars: A New Hope. Just like the recent release Rogue One: A Star Wars Story.
